Output 27d686670687e031bd5f91ee4d1a3ca898334d813c2cfc814295ecc35ea7a5e4:3

value
6437126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e160721ddba220e52d936a413aed8264df6b8632 OP_EQUALVERIFY OP_CHECKSIG
address
1MYgaLDTsg3RKJiMFWoqAFtNxEsvVotG9D
transaction
27d686670687e031bd5f91ee4d1a3ca898334d813c2cfc814295ecc35ea7a5e4
spent
true